Claims
- 1. A method for producing strands comprising extruding a material from an orifice submerged in a flow of coagulation agent that shears off strands of the material and solidifies the material in that form,
wherein the material is selected from the group consisting of collagen, hyaluronic acid, mixtures of collagen and hyaluronic acid, poly-glycolic acid, and poly-lactic acid, wherein the coagulation agent comprises a dehydrating agent that is selected from the group consisting of dextran, polyethylene glycol, isopropyl alcohol and acetone, and wherein the strands are filtered from the coagulation agent.
- 2. The method of claim 1, wherein the filtered strands are concentrated.
- 3. A method for producing and concentrating strands comprising: (i) extruding a material from an orifice submerged in a flow of coagulation agent that shears off strands of the material and solidifies the material in that form, and (ii) concentrating the strands,
wherein the material is selected from the group consisting of collagen, hyaluronic acid, mixtures of collagen and hyaluronic acid, poly-glycolic acid, and poly-lactic acid, and wherein the coagulation agent comprises a dehydrating agent that is selected from the group consisting of dextran, polyethylene glycol, isopropyl alcohol and acetone.
- 4. The method of claim 3, wherein the material being extruded comprises collagen in solution.
- 5. The method of claim 3, wherein concentrating the strands comprises forcing a dilute solution of strands back and forth in an alternating matter, through the lumen of a tangential flow filter whereby transluminal effluent passes through the filter resulting in a more concentrated solution of strands.
- 6. The method of claim 5, wherein the material being extruded comprises collagen in solution.
- 7. The method of claim 3, wherein concentrating the strands comprises drying a dilute solution of strands and reconstituting the dried strands with the appropriate fluid volume.
- 8. The method of claim 3, wherein concentrating the strands comprises compacting a dilute solution of strands between porous filters.
- 9. The method of claim 3, wherein concentrating the strands comprises filling solid or mesh porous molds with a dilute solution of strands.
- 10. The method of claim 3, wherein concentrating the strands comprises partially desiccating a dilute solution of strands by placing it in contact with porous materials.
